Added "name" field to digest algorithms
authorMichael Brown <mcb30@etherboot.org>
Tue, 21 Nov 2006 16:14:50 +0000 (16:14 +0000)
committerMichael Brown <mcb30@etherboot.org>
Tue, 21 Nov 2006 16:14:50 +0000 (16:14 +0000)
src/crypto/md5.c
src/include/gpxe/crypto.h

index 2aa2102..182b625 100644 (file)
@@ -234,6 +234,7 @@ static void md5_finish(void *context, void *out)
 }
 
 struct digest_algorithm md5_algorithm = {
+       .name           = "md5",
        .context_len    = sizeof ( struct md5_ctx ),
        .digest_len     = MD5_DIGEST_SIZE,
        .init           = md5_init,
index e2a728f..023a002 100644 (file)
@@ -14,6 +14,8 @@
  *
  */
 struct digest_algorithm {
+       /** Algorithm name */
+       const char *name;
        /** Size of a context for this algorithm */
        size_t context_len;
        /** Size of a message digest for this algorithm */